The IS0150AU is an isolation amplifier manufactured by Burr-Brown, which is now part of Texas Instruments (TI). It is designed to provide galvanic isolation between input and output signals, protecting sensitive circuits from high voltages and common-mode noise. This isolation amplifier is used in a variety of applications where signal integrity and safety are critical.

Technical Specifications
The IS0150AU provides a high level of galvanic isolation, typically up to several kilovolts. It features low nonlinearity, ensuring accurate signal transmission. The isolation amplifier has a wide bandwidth, allowing it to handle a broad range of signal frequencies. It operates with a single-ended input and output, simplifying circuit design. The device is available in a compact package, saving valuable board space. High common-mode rejection ensures that noise and interference are minimized. The operating temperature range is typically from -40°C to +85°C, making it suitable for industrial applications. The IS0150AU is designed to meet stringent safety standards and provide reliable isolation in critical applications.
